About St John's Christian Academy
Long before St. John's Christian Academy, Lord Berkeley Academy was established in 1966 and faithfully served the educational needs of children and young people in Moncks Corner and Berkeley County through May of 1998. What Is the Cost of Living Near Charleston?

Understanding the cost of living near Charleston is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at St John's Christian Academy.
Charleston's Cost of Living Index is approximately 111.5 (11.5% more expensive than US average; 17.0% more than SC average). Historic coastal city, major tourism, very high housing costs in desirable areas. CARTA bus, DASH (free downtown).
